Carvalho # Date 1152293631 10800 # Node ID 276de216d2c5c0a9fffb07dc0688115567ca3548 # Parent 54b15237958981fa6d4c0c3692fc9cd7191e52d5 Respect "Connection: close" headers sent by HTTP clients. A HTTP client can indicate that it doesn't support (or doesn't want) persistent connections by sending this header. This not only makes the server more compliant with the RFC, but also reduces the run time of test-http-proxy when run with python 2.3 from ~125s to ~5s (it doesn't affect it with python 2.4, which was already ~5s). diff -r 54b152379589 -r 276de216d2c5 mercurial/hgweb/server.py --- a/mercurial/hgweb/server.py Sun Jul 09 11:10:11 2006 +0200 +++ b/mercurial/hgweb/server.py Fri Jul 07 14:33:51 2006 -0300 @@ -127,6 +127,11 @@ if h[0].lower() == 'content-length': should_close = False self.length = int(h[1]) + # The value of the Connection header is a list of case-insensitive + # tokens separated by commas and optional whitespace. + if 'close' in [token.strip().lower() for token in + self.headers.get('connection', '').split(',')]: + should_close = True if should_close: self.send_header('Connection', 'close') self.close_connection = should_close
